본문 바로가기

Programming

(40)
자바스크립트 JS (3). 데이터 타입(=자료형) / typeof() 명령 변수에 저장(초기화)할 수 있는 값의 종류를 '데이터 타입' 혹은 '자료형'이라 한다. JS의 변수에는 숫자형, 문자열, true, false 값을 저장할 수 있다. true / false는 명제의 참/거짓을 나타낼 때 사용하는 데이터 타입으로, 불형(boolean type)이라 부른다. 불형은 해당 조건이 만족할 경우(참) true로, 만족하지 않을 경우(거짓) false로 표현한다. --예시-- var a=100; b=3.14; //숫자형 var c="안녕하세요"; d="a"; //문자열 var e=true; f=false; //불형 typeof 명령 typeof는 ()안에 들어있는 변수가 어떤 데이터 타입인지 알려주는 명령이다. --예시-- var a=100; b=3.14; //숫자형 var c="..
자바스크립트 JS (2). 변수 var 변수란? 프로그램을 작성할 때 어떤 결과를 계산하거나 계산한 결과를 나중에 활용하기 위해 기록해둘 공간(컵)이 필요하다. 이러한 정보를 저장해 둘 수 있는 공간이 바로 변수이다. 변수 선언 예를 들어 a라는 변수를 선언한다면 : var a *var = variable(변수) *쉼표로 변수를 여러개 나열해서 한꺼번에 선언가능. >var a,b,c (띄어쓰기 생략가능) 변수 초기화 이렇게 a라는 변수를 선언하면 값을 저정할 공간이 만들어지지만, 만든 공간에는 아무런 값이 들어 있지 않은 상태이다. 만든 변수를 사용하려면 변수에 값을 넣어야 하는데, 이런 작업을 초기화 라고 한다. 즉, 변수에 처음으로 값을 넣는(저장하는) 작업을 말한다. >a=10; //변수 초기화함. var a=10; //변수 선언과 초기..
자바스크립트 JS (1). 출력 - alert() 명령 / console.log() 명령 브라우저에서 경고 메시지를 출력하는 코드 : alert("문자열") ; (세미콜론은 선택사항) head태그 내부에 script 작성하기. 자바스크립트에서 명령을 실행할 때는 명령(재료); 명령과 재료 사이의 괄호에 주목! console.log() 명령을 이용해서 메시지 출력하기. //개발자도구(ctrl+shift+I /F12)에서 Console 탭을 눌러 확인. >console.log("Hello World")
css3 / 구글폰트 웹 폰트 적용하기 - 구글폰트(크롬으로 들어가기) https://fonts.google.com/ Google Fonts Making the web more beautiful, fast, and open through great typography fonts.google.com 마음에 드는 폰트를 주황색+버튼을 누르면, 사진과 같이 오른쪽에 작은 창이 뜬다. 코드를 복사하고 link href=뒤에 붙여넣기. (참고로 여러 폰트를 +한 뒤(장바구니 담듯) 한꺼번에 코드를 복사한다) 그리고 복사했던 코드 밑에 Specify in CSS 코드가 하나더 있는데 이것도 복사해서 style 시트 선택자 속성에 붙여넣기. Lorem Cillum aliqua do aliqua duis qui adipisicing com..
css3 / 초기화코드 모든 html 페이지의 첫 번째 스타일시트는 초기화코드로 시작한다. 초기화 코드는 모든 웹 브라우저에서 동일한 출력 결과를 만들기 위해 사용. 마진과 패딩을 모두 0로 지정, 폰트 강제 지정, 폰트 크기, 입력 양식의 사이즈 통일 등을 동일하게 맞춰주기 초기화 코드 링크 1. Eric Meyer's Reset CSS : 모든 것을 초기화함.(조금 안해주는 것도 있긴함..그런건 직접) http://meyerweb.com/eric/tools/css/reset/ CSS Tools: Reset CSS CSS Tools: Reset CSS The goal of a reset stylesheet is to reduce browser inconsistencies in things like default line he..
css3 / 레이아웃(3) - clear: both, flex 속성 4. clear: both(=overflow: hidden) - float속성+clear속성을 사용한 레이아웃 구성 방법. - clear: both 입력. 또는 - 자식에 width, float을 주고 부모태그에 after, clear:both; content: ' '; display:block 입력. (참고로, 자식태그(aside, section)를 따로 감싸주는 부모태그(container)가 없어도 됨) Header /*clear란 막을 사용해서 overflow된것처럼 보이나, 자식을 못알아봄. 막 때문에 못 파고든것. clear를 쓸 땐 부모태그(container) 자체가 필요없음. 서로 못알아보는데 있어서 뭐해.. */ Aside Velit ad esse deserunt mollit ea exer..
css3 / 레이아웃(2) - float 속성을 사용한 수평정렬 3. float 속성을 사용한 수평정렬. "자식에 width, float을 주고 부모에 overflow: hidden" 레이아웃 기본 : 수평정렬(가로로 자를 수 있는 부분(header/navigation/content/footer)이 하나하나 태그가 됨)을 기준으로 함.) 그 다음 내부에서 세로로 자를 수 있는 부분(content-aside/section)은 그 내부의 자식요소로 구성하게 됨. float 속성을 사용하면 aside, section 부분을 수평으로 정렬할 수 있다. Header Navigation (부모) (자식) Non et consectetur elit dolor irure eu ullamco. Deserunt et qui velit nostrud. Cillum esse dolore ..
css3 / 레이아웃(1) - float 속성, 중앙정렬 1. float 속성의 기본 : 그림을 글자 위에 띄우기 위해 만들어진 스타일속성. 실제론 기본적인 것으로 활용하진 않고 특이하게 사용많이 함. 레이아웃 구성할 때. float: left - 태그를 왼쪽에 붙인다. float: right - 태그를 오른쪽에 붙인다. Excepteur consectetur exercitation ea id cillum eiusmod eu dolor minim deserunt nulla ipsum. In labore pariatur proident laborum tempor occaecat reprehenderit elit esse irure Lorem. Voluptate qui laboris commodo magna nisi qui. Quis sint eu tempor e..